1992, my first trip to Nepal. I visited a manufactory hoping that my criteria for quality and appreciative treatment of the employees would be met. My designs should be implemented to classic "Tibetans", in high Nepalese craftsmanship. I immediately felt at home and learned to love the country and its people. That was the start of  decades of cooperation and valuable friendships.

My carpet paintings are loved in Europe, the quality appreciated and after the first difficult years without computers and with long postal routes they became a success story combining  western design with Nepalese craftsmanship in the highest quality.

My concept "Gender Project for Women in Nepal" was launched and the pilot project was carried out by the NGO Ecohimal with the Austrian Foreign Ministry.
